The Connection Between Music and Happiness

Research has shown that music has the ability to induce positive emotions and enhance feelings of happiness. When we listen to upbeat and lively music, our brain releases dopamine, a neurotransmitter associated with pleasure and reward. This release of dopamine contributes to our overall sense of well-being and can boost our mood.

Moreover, music has been found to have physiological effects on our bodies. It can lower our heart rate, reduce stress levels, and even decrease the perception of pain. These physiological responses further support the idea that music can influence our happiness and well-being.

How Different Genres and Styles Impact Happiness

While music has a positive overall impact on happiness, the specific genres and styles of music we listen to can evoke different emotions and moods. Upbeat and energetic genres such as pop, dance, and reggae are often associated with feelings of joy, happiness, and motivation. These genres typically have catchy melodies, uplifting lyrics, and a fast tempo, which contribute to their positive effect on mood.

On the other hand, slow and melodic genres like classical music or certain types of instrumental music can evoke a sense of calmness and relaxation. These genres are often used in therapeutic settings to reduce anxiety and promote emotional well-being.

Interestingly, personal preferences also play a significant role in determining how specific music impacts our happiness. A song or genre that brings immense joy to one person may have little effect on another. This highlights the importance of exploring and understanding our unique musical tastes to maximize the positive impact of music on our happiness.

The Role of Lyrics in Music’s Impact on Happiness

While the melodies and rhythms of music have a powerful effect on our emotions, the lyrics of songs can further enhance or shape our emotional experiences. Lyrics that convey positive and uplifting messages, such as themes of love, gratitude, empowerment, or resilience, can have a significant impact on our happiness. These lyrics can resonate with us on a deep level, reminding us of the good things in life and encouraging a positive outlook.

Additionally, personal experiences and memories associated with specific songs or lyrics can trigger strong emotions and enhance our overall happiness. Nostalgic songs can transport us back in time, evoking happy memories and creating a sense of connection to our past selves.

It’s important, however, to recognize that not all lyrics are positive or promote happiness. Certain genres of music, such as some forms of rap or metal, might express darker, introspective, or controversial themes. While these genres may appeal to some individuals and have their benefits, it is essential to approach them with awareness and moderation to maintain a balance in our emotional well-being.

Examples of Music’s Impact on Happiness

There are countless examples of how music has positively impacted individuals’ lives, bringing joy and happiness in various ways. Consider the case of an individual going through a challenging period, experiencing low mood or stress. Simply listening to their favorite songs can provide a much-needed boost in mood and help them cultivate a more positive mindset.

Music can also enhance social connections and strengthen relationships. Attending concerts or music festivals allows people to come together and share the joy of music as a collective experience. Singing or playing instruments in a community group or choir provides a sense of belonging and camaraderie.

Furthermore, music therapy has emerged as a valuable intervention in clinical settings. It is used to alleviate symptoms of anxiety, depression, and even chronic pain. Patients undergoing medical procedures or treatments often find solace and distraction through the use of music, promoting a greater sense of happiness and well-being.

In addition to individual experiences, music has played a significant role on a larger scale, such as during times of celebration or cultural events. The rhythmic beats and melodies of music have been central in traditions, ceremonies, and rituals across various cultures, amplifying joy and happiness within communities.
